Can someone explain me the difference between expenditure-dampening and expenditure-switching policies?

1 Answer

5 votes
Expenditure switching policy is a policy which government tends to switch the consumer's purchase on foreign goods to domestic goods

Expenditure dampening policy is reducing the consumption of imported goods to ensure that the balance of payment of a country becomes better
